First, a uniform viscous and incompressible flow past a circular cylinder was simulated by using the Ansys/Flotran CFD software, then the induced vibration for a viscous flow past a circular cylinder supported by elastic spring and dash pot was simulated with the Ansys/Flotran CFD software and stepwise integration. The lift forces and transverse responses were analyzed with the fast fourier transform(FFT). By analyzing the calculation results, some useful conclusions were given, which may be used in the designing of equipments with viscous flow past a circular cylinder supported by elastic spring and dashpot.
